Regarding Kalias, if you speak to him as a lizard (alive or cloaked undead) other than as The Red Prince, he will ask you "which house". If you respond with the option "house of war" he will offer you a discount on his gear. Bear in mind, if you sell gear back to him, that gear will also be sold back at a discount.
You can do it with red price just denie that you are red prince
If you have the Soldier tag (Ifan or custom character), he'll give you a discount for that. Ifan also has the human racial bonus to Bartering.

Get Adrenaline on ALL your characters by Level 4:
1. If you have an Elf in your party, you can eat the flesh of the murder victim on the ship and get it for free. Save it for when Sebelle joins your party or you get Fane's mask of the shapeshifter back.
2. Hilde sells Scoundrel skillbooks, so buy an Adrenaline book from her every time you level up.
3. After you escape Fort Joy, Exter sells them in the Sanctuary of Amadia.

What is a good way to strip physical and magic armor? It seems silly to think we just waste good attacks and spells in any order until we win by armor attrition.
You want to open with your skills that cause the most raw damage, and save the crowd control skills for enemies whose armor is down. For example, don't waste a Knockdown move on enemies whose physical armor is high enough to resist the status effect. As soon as your crowd-control skills can do enough damage to chew through the remaining armor, that's when you want to use them.
The Torturer talent lets you inflict certain statuses through armor, but not all of them. Having at least one Mage with a lot of crowd control spells that work with Torturer can be a big help in the first round of combat (e.g., a Geomancer who can Slow, Cripple, and Entangle all the enemy melee fighters through their armor).
